EDGAR Form N-PORT XML Technical Specification (Version 1.7)

Implementation Date: June 10, 2019

The Form N-PORT XML Technical Specification (Version 1.7) document describes the valid structure and content of the Form N-PORT Electronic Data Gathering, Analysis, and Retrieval (EDGAR) Extensible Markup Language (XML) submission types. This specification provides a basis for creating Form N-PORT submissions. The expectation is that software developers, working on behalf of filers, will be able to construct software that will generate a Form N-PORT submission that can be successfully processed by the EDGAR system.

The Form N-PORT submission file must conform to the EDGAR Form N-PORT Submission Taxonomy for the EDGAR system. This taxonomy comprises a collection of XML Schema Definition (.xsd) files that defines the structure of EDGAR Form N-PORT submissions. The Form N-PORT XML submissions can be transmitted to the SEC via the ‘Transmit’ link on the EDGAR FilerWeb (https://www.edgarfiling.sec.gov/) or the ‘Transmit XML Submission’ link on the EDGAR OnlineForms Website (https://www.onlineforms.edgarfiling.sec.gov).
